01. Edge Computing

The processing of data as close to the source as possible thus minimizing the latency and making the application more suitable for real-time use scenarios.

Perfect for Internet of Things, Augmented/Virtual Reality, and instant analytics.

02. Serverless Computing

Serverless management is now possible allowing developers to focus more on code writing giving them the liberty to be more creative.

It has the option of pay-as-you-go pricing and features such as auto-scaling.

03. Hybrid and Multi-Cloud

The public and private cloud environments can be combined which offers flexibility and risk averted compliance.

They are the one-stop solutions to a series of issues like data vendor lock-in and data sovereignty.
